You're in luck. "The Pee-Wee Herman Show" runs January 12 - February 7 (tickets are on-sale now), and we've got tickets for some lucky fans to see the show on Wednesday, January 13.
The show is an all-new production featuring Pee-wee in a hilarious stage show that reunites him with his Playhouse Gang friends and follows him on his quest to fulfill his lifelong dream of flying. The roles of Miss Yvonne, Mailman Mike and Jambi are all being reprised by the original actors, with 11 actors and 19 puppets taking the stage in all.
